A loose wire in the breaker box is a fire hazard and must be addressed by a Licensed Electrical Contractor. Working inside the main service panel is dangerous — even with the main breaker turned off, the service entrance conductors connecting the utility to the panel remain energized at all times and cannot be de-energized without the utility disconnecting power at the meter. Do not attempt to tighten wires in the panel yourself unless you are a licensed electrician.
A Licensed Electrical Contractor will shut off the main breaker to de-energize the panel buses, identify the loose connection, and re-terminate the conductor using the correct torque. For aluminum service entrance conductors, anti-oxidant compound is used at the connection point. If a breaker shows heat damage or the bus bar is discoloured, the breaker or the panel section may need to be replaced — a visual inspection of the existing damage will determine the extent of repair needed. An ESA permit is required for repairs that involve replacing breakers or modifying circuit connections.
